How is the concept of Organizational Excellence evolving with the rise of remote work and digital transformation?

Organizational Excellence, a concept deeply rooted in the continuous improvement of processes, leadership, and culture, is undergoing a significant evolution driven by the rise of remote work and digital transformation. These shifts are not merely changes in where and how work is done but are transforming the very essence of organizational strategies, operations, and cultures. This evolution demands a rethinking of traditional models of excellence, integrating new technologies, and adapting to a more flexible and distributed workforce.

Impact of Remote Work on Organizational Excellence

The transition to remote work has fundamentally altered the landscape of Organizational Excellence. It has necessitated a shift in focus towards digital communication tools, virtual collaboration, and the management of a distributed workforce. A study by Gartner highlighted that over 80% of company leaders plan to allow employees to work remotely at least part of the time after the pandemic. This shift requires organizations to rethink their approach to Performance Management, ensuring that it is suited to a remote context. Performance metrics have moved away from time-based evaluations to a more results-oriented approach, emphasizing outcomes over processes.

Remote work has also brought to the forefront the importance of digital literacy across all levels of an organization. Training and development programs have had to adapt rapidly, incorporating digital tools and platforms to support continuous learning in a remote environment. This has implications for Leadership Development, with a greater emphasis on leading distributed teams, fostering digital collaboration, and maintaining employee engagement and productivity from afar.

Moreover, the rise of remote work has highlighted the need for a strong organizational culture that transcends physical boundaries. Organizations are now focusing on building a sense of belonging and shared purpose among remote employees, leveraging digital platforms to facilitate communication, collaboration, and community. This has led to innovative approaches to maintaining and strengthening organizational culture, such as virtual team-building activities and digital "water cooler" spaces.

Digital Transformation and its Influence on Organizational Excellence

Digital Transformation has become a cornerstone of Organizational Excellence, enabling organizations to optimize operations, enhance customer experiences, and innovate products and services. According to McKinsey, companies that digitize processes can expect to see a 20-30% increase in efficiency. This transformation involves the integration of digital technology into all areas of an organization, fundamentally changing how it operates and delivers value to customers. It requires a holistic approach, encompassing not just technology, but also people and processes.

Operational Excellence has been redefined in the context of digital transformation. Automation, artificial intelligence, and advanced analytics are being leveraged to streamline processes, reduce errors, and make data-driven decisions. This shift not only improves efficiency but also enhances agility, enabling organizations to respond more quickly to market changes and customer needs. For example, Amazon's use of robotics and AI in its fulfillment centers has set a new standard for operational efficiency and customer service in the retail sector.

The role of leadership in driving digital transformation cannot be overstated. Leaders must champion a culture of innovation, encouraging experimentation and learning from failure. They must also manage the change process effectively, addressing resistance and ensuring that employees have the skills and support needed to adapt to new ways of working. This requires a significant investment in Change Management and Leadership Development, with a focus on digital skills and agile methodologies.

Integrating Remote Work and Digital Transformation for Organizational Excellence

To achieve Organizational Excellence in this new era, organizations must integrate the principles of remote work and digital transformation into their strategic planning and daily operations. This integration involves creating a seamless digital workplace that supports collaboration and productivity, regardless of physical location. It also requires a reevaluation of key performance indicators (KPIs) to reflect the value of digital initiatives and the effectiveness of remote teams.

Organizations must also prioritize the digital upskilling of their workforce. As digital tools and platforms become central to operations, employees at all levels need to be proficient in using them. This not only enhances individual performance but also ensures that the organization can fully leverage the benefits of digital transformation.

Finally, maintaining a strong organizational culture is critical in a digital and remote work environment. Leaders must find ways to instill and reinforce the organization's values, mission, and vision, ensuring that employees feel connected and engaged, regardless of where they work. This might involve adopting new digital tools for communication and collaboration, as well as reimagining traditional engagement activities for a virtual context.

In conclusion, the evolution of Organizational Excellence in the age of remote work and digital transformation presents both challenges and opportunities. Organizations that successfully navigate this evolution will be those that are agile, innovative, and capable of leveraging digital technologies to enhance their operations, culture, and leadership.
